What is 45 percent off 9.90 Dollars
The easiest way of calculating discount is, in this case, to multiply the normal price $9.9 by 45 then divide it by one hundred. So, the discount equals $4.46. To calculate the sales price, simply deduct the discount of $4.46 from the original price $9.9 then get $5.45 as the sales price.

1) What is 45 percent (%) off $9.90?
Using the formula one and replacing the given values:
Amount Saved = Original Price x Discount % / 100. So,
Amount Saved = 9.90 x 45 / 100
Amount Saved = 445.5 / 100
Amount Saved = $4.46 (answer)
In other words, a 45% discount for an item with the original price of $9.90 is equal to $4.455 (Amount Saved).
Note that to find the amount saved, just multiply it by the percentage and divide by 100.

2) How much do you pay for an item of $9.90 when discounted 45 percent (%)? What is the item's sale price?
Using the formula two and replacing the given values:
Sale Price = Original Price - Amount Saved. So,
Sale Price = 9.90 - 4.455
Sale Price = $5.45 (answer)
This means the cost of the item to you is $5.45.
You will pay $5.45 for an item with an original price of $9.90 when discounted by 45%. In other words, if you buy an item at $9.90 with a 45% discount, you pay $9.90 - 4.455 = $5.45
